What Are Safety Helmets?
Safety helmets, often referred to as hard hats, are protective headgear designed to shield the wearer's head from injuries caused by falling objects, collisions, or falls. They are essential in any environment where overhead hazards exist. In a fast-food setting like McDonald's, such hazards can include the risk of heavy objects falling from storage racks or the potential for accidents during the construction and maintenance of restaurant facilities.
